The ties that bind indeed....what exactly are they? Well lets start with the two in the car...
This is a different Katze from the one in the Not Happy Jan Chapter. This Katze feels he still has a hand to play in the game. A false premise perhaps, but at least he is thinking again.
Iason Mink, for all his physical perfection and super intelligence is a fraud. Do as I say, not as I do is his bylaw. He questions Katze on Raoul and yet when Katze has the chutzpah to throw a truth at him about his relationship with a Mongrel, his Excellency gets all uppity. For all his cool posturing, Jupiters' Chosen is an emotional mess. Since he cannot accept the fact that he does have feelings, his behaviour is erratic, violent, and at the best of times pensive. He has a conscience. Which is why this drive is not as Katze suspects a diversion to keep their destination hidden, but a useless stall because the last thing Iason wants to do is hand him over to Jupiter. ( He might live to serve, but it doesn’t mean he likes it. ) This is not a friendship, far from it, so perhaps we should call it loyalty. But it is something that ties them together. Iason feels guilt. And I say this because in BMR (that last chapter) Jupiter says to Iason
“ It will be painless, Iason. I will allow him that grace for the Creator’s sake.”
Why give this assurance at all, unless the machine (note the genderless word to describe the A1..and no I still disagree) senses the guilt in Iason over what he has to do. Forget his misgivings on how Raoul and Riki will act if the truth comes out. That moment was about his ‘feelings’ towards Katze and Jupiters request. Hence her intervention at that moment with her platitude as if this would make it all palatable and right.
And just as an aside, I loved how Admon made an appearance in this chapter….and you can’t tell me he didn’t…
The dealer felt a cold chill pass through him and he involuntarily shuddered before adjusting his jacket. How odd, just as it came it went quickly replaced by soothing warmth emboldening his confident stance.
That soothing warmth is Admon…..so even though he doesn’t realize it, Katze is not facing Jupiter alone.
Now I could wax on still about things that went on in this part alone, but lets get on to Riki…
Who though mongrel is more astute than his so called Master. How quickly he puts it together, his missing Com with Iason hovering over the jacket.
And, “you get what you paid for”….another true maxim. Riki acknowledges that he gets the finer things in life by being a ‘pet’. But, to be allowed that little bit of extra space, he has to also give up some fight, and submit more to Iason’s will.
However even in this he remains himself, constantly shoving it to the Blondie, knowing that those emotions are lying just below a fine surface. Is it any wonder then, he likes the idea that Iason has to show emotional restraint, if he wants to keep
a semblance of peace with his mongrel. He too has to know what battles to fight. And a pair of worn boots though irritating, is not worth the hassle of upsetting Riki. Oh yes, there is much tooing and throwing here on the little things by both of them. But it’s the big things that count in the end….
And lastly Nii Nii and Raoul….well Nii Nii is the consummate player. And if you get beyond the posturing and attitude, there is one truth here that can’t be over looked, no matter how Raoul wants to ignore it. The Elites in the scheme of thing may be the top of the pecking order, but they too only live to serve Jupiter. Personal freedoms are in fact limited to what Jupiter deems correct. And what better way to keep control than to make sure emotions don’t run rampart. The gloves are not a fashion statement, and relationships are banned for a reason. No one must come before the machine. No wonder there is hatred for the Mongrel who takes up so much of the Chosen One’s attention.
